摘要
The 2 mating type loci MATa and MAT.alpha. each produce 2 mRNAs that are transcribed in opposite and diverging directions from central promoters. Silent copies of MATa (HMRa) and MAT.alpha. (HML.alpha.) contain identical DNA sequences throughout the transcribed region, yet are not transcribed. Sequences to the left of HMRa (and probably HML.alpha.) must somehow affect transcription initiated at the center of each locus 700-1400 base pairs away. A possible mechanism for this position effect is discussed.
